    I can totally see Google taking on Facebook and invigorating another social networking development platform. Windows Live has one, as does Yahoo. Question is, who is going to build the platform for the platforms, so things will work everywhere?

    Quoted: As I see it, the biggest shortcoming of social-networking sites is their inability to play well with others. Between MySpace, Facebook, LinkedIn, Tribe, Pownce, and the numerous also-rans, it seems as if maintaining an active presence at all of these sites could erode into becoming a full-time job. If Google can somehow create a means for all of these services to work together, and seamlessly interact with the Google family, then perhaps this is the killer app that people don't even realize they've been waiting for.
